    I'm interested in learning how to make a mod for Nexuiz in QuakeC. I saw this tutorial here which makes it sound pretty simple:

    http://www.moddb.com/games/nexuiz/tutor ... uiz-part-1

    That's clearly an outdated tutorial but from reading it I basically figured out some idea of how you're supposed to compile a mod for Nexuiz- I think. So I thought I'd give it a go.

    I couldn't find the game dir they refer to in my Nexuiz dir, but I found a folder called qcsrc. I copied everything from that to mymod. Then, using the fteqcc that came with Nexuiz, I opened progs.src in the server folder in mymod. That loaded up loads of stuff in fteqcc, so I clicked compile. It seemed to compile properly because there were no warnings.

    Then I loaded up nexuiz.exe -game mymod. When I tried to create a new multiplayer game, it wouldn't start. There was also an error message: something along the lines of "please update defaultconfig to match the quakec code".

    So does anyone know what's going wrong here? It'd be great to find out because it actually seems pretty simple to edit this stuff (I've programmed C++ for a year or two so have an idea of how the code works).

  • bengreenwood wrote:Hi,
    Then I loaded up nexuiz.exe -game mymod. When I tried to create a new multiplayer game, it wouldn't start. There was also an error message: something along the lines of "please update defaultconfig to match the quakec code".


    To work around this, use the following cvars before starting a game:

    cvar_check_default bypass
    cvar_check_weapons bypass

  • Yeah, for some reason, the source files that ship with nexuiz 2.5.1 are not synced to the config file D:

    The actual source snapshot is available on svn, though, but I have no idea what revision number it was :p
